We extend the formalism of statistical mechanics developed for the two-dimensional (2D) Euler equation to the case of shallow water system. Relaxation equations towards the maximum entropy state are proposed, which provide a parametrization of subgrid-scale eddies in 2D compressible turbulence.

On the basis of the integrable Kaup–Boussinesq version of the shallow-water equations, an analytical theory of undular bores is constructed. A complete classification for the problem of the decay of an initial discontinuity is made.
The method of weak asymptotics is used to find singular solutions of the shallow-water system which can contain Dirac-δ distributions (Espinosa & Omel’yanov, 2005). Complex-valued approximations which become real-valued in the distributional limit are shown to extend the range of possible singular solutions. The traditional shallow water model for waves propagating over varying bathymetry depends for its derivation on the asymptotic analysis of a Dirichlet-Neumann operator. This analysis however is restricted to smoothly varying topographies. We propose an adaptation to one dimensional polygonal bottoms using the conformal mapping idea of Hamilton and Nachbin.
